Release Date for Marvel Rivals Season 2 Hellfire Gala
Marvel Rivals, the popular hero shooter developed by NetEase and inspired by the acclaimed comic book universe, has garnered significant attention since its debut in December 2024 with Season 0, followed by a successful first season in early 2025 that featured all four members of the Fantastic Four. The game’s seasonal structure mirrors that of other contemporary shooters and online games, introducing fresh playable content such as characters, maps, and game modes on a regular basis at no additional charge. Players can also participate in in-game missions and special events to earn free currency known as Units, enabling them to purchase items directly from the store without having to spend Lattice, the game’s premium currency. This suggests that regular players should invest in the latest battle pass while saving earned Lattice for future purchases, and actively seek out Units to acquire additional skins and packs from the shop. Notably, battle passes in Marvel Rivals do not expire at the conclusion of each season, allowing players to complete them at their convenience without feeling rushed, unless they are eager to unlock a specific skin. Even after the commencement of Season 2, players who purchased the Season 1 pass can continue progressing through it as long as it was acquired during its availability.
Marvel Rivals Season 2 Hellfire Gala Release Date
The highly anticipated second season of Marvel Rivals is set to launch later this week and will span a duration of three months. The Hellfire Gala for Season 2 is scheduled to kick off on April 11th, 2025, at 8 AM UTC. This season will adhere to the three-month timeline established in Season 1, although it will introduce fewer new characters. It is designed to serve as a transitional phase between the character-rich first season led by the Fantastic Four and the upcoming seasonal structure planned for Season 3 and beyond, which will feature two new heroes or villains every two months—essentially one new character per month. “It’s the most glamorous night of the year, darling—Emma Frost herself invites you to the Hellfire Gala on Krakoa! Marvel Rivals Season 2 Hellfire Gala Details
Season 2 of Marvel Rivals will introduce two new characters: Emma Frost and Ultron, alongside a new Krakoa map designed for the Domination game mode that will be available from the start of the season. Emma Frost will serve as a Vanguard (tank) hero, focusing on crowd control rather than traditional tanking strategies. Her psychic and diamond abilities will require careful planning and execution to maximize their effectiveness. Additionally, she can synergize with teammates like Magneto and Psylocke if they are included in the player’s roster. However, Ultron will not be available at the launch of Season 2 but will make his debut in a mid-May update, known as Season 2.5. Players can expect Ultron to be a Strategist character, utilizing his drones to assist the team, despite his villainous role in the overarching narrative of the game.
